Unicode Character "ɂ" (U+0242)
The character ɂ (Latin Small Letter Glottal Stop) is represented by the Unicode codepoint U+0242. It is encoded in the Latin Extended-B block, which belongs to the Basic Multilingual Plane. It was added to Unicode in version 5.0 (July, 2006). It is HTML encoded as ɂ.
